免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

h5框架和vue开发移动app

H5框架和Vue开发移动App是当前非常流行和常用的技术组合。在介绍相关原理和详细信息之前,需要先了解一些基础知识。

H5框架(或称为Hybrid App)是指在移动应用中使用网页技术(HTML、CSS和JavaScript)开发的跨平台应用。它通过WebView来实现应用的UI展示和逻辑控制,并且可以借助Native API实现一些特定的功能。H5框架的优势在于快速开发和跨平台兼容性。

Vue是一种现代化的JavaScript框架,用于构建用户界面。它采用了组件化的开发模式,使代码更加模块化和易于维护。Vue提供了数据驱动的视图组件和强大的工具集,以提升开发效率和用户体验。

结合H5框架和Vue进行移动App开发,可以充分利用网页技术的灵活性和Vue框架的高效性能。下面是具体的原理和步骤:

1. 创建项目:首先,你需要创建一个基于Vue的H5框架项目。可以使用脚手架工具如Vue CLI来快速生成项目结构。

2. 组件开发:使用Vue框架的核心功能,编写各种组件。Vue的组件可以包含模板、样式和脚本,并且可以实现数据双向绑定、事件处理等功能。

3. 路由配置:使用Vue Router插件来实现应用的路由功能。可以定义不同路径对应的组件,并且通过路由导航实现页面之间的切换。

4. 状态管理:使用Vue的状态管理库Vuex来管理应用的状态。Vuex提供了集中化存储和管理数据的方法,方便不同组件之间的数据共享和状态管理。

5. 打包和部署:使用Webpack等打包工具对应用进行打包,生成可部署的静态文件。然后将这些文件上传到服务器或发布到应用商店,用户可以通过下载安装来使用你的应用。

在使用H5框架和Vue开发移动App的过程中,还可以结合一些第三方插件来扩展功能,如Axios用于HTTP请求、Vant用于UI组件等。

总结起来,H5框架和Vue开发移动App的原理是基于网页技术和Vue框架的组合。它们提供了快速开发、跨平台兼容性和良好的用户体验。通过组件化、路由配置和状态管理等功能,可以实现复杂的应用逻辑和交互效果。这种开发方式在现代移动应用开发中得到广泛应用,对于入门开发人员来说也是一个很好的学习和实践的方向。


相关知识:
kotlin可以完全开发一个app吗
Kotlin 是一种现代化的编程语言,它在 Android 开发中拥有广泛的应用。事实上,Kotlin 已经成为 Android 官方支持的一种开发语言。那么,通过使用 Kotlin,可以完全开发一个 Android 应用吗?本文将详细介绍 Kotlin
2023-07-14
app低代码开发平台的优势有哪些
低代码开发平台是一种通过可视化拖拽与设置属性等方式来构建应用程序的软件,可以快速地创建出可以运行的应用。运用低代码平台,可以让程序开发人员专注于业务逻辑及程序的优化,而不必关心实现细节,从而快速地构建出应用。相比传统的应用开发方式,低代码开发平台有很多优势
2023-05-06
apple的app开发
苹果公司出品的iOS操作系统是目前最流行的移动操作系统之一,而iOS应用程序也被称为App,它们是安装在iPhone、iPad或iPod touch设备上的软件程序。在App Store里,开发者可以发布自己的App,用户可以浏览和下载这些App,享受到各
2023-05-06
apple内购ios开发
在iOS开发领域,内购是一个非常重要的组成部分。内购表示在你的应用中可以使用苹果的支付系统来售卖数字物品。从苹果应用商店下载安装应用程序是一种很方便的方式,很多人都喜欢这个方式。开发者可以通过在应用程序中集成内购功能来售卖购买的项目、服务或者其他数字产品。
2023-05-06
appinventor类似的开发工具
App Inventor是一款非常流行的开源的移动应用程序开发工具,它使得无需编写代码的人能够构建Android应用程序。如果你使用过App Inventor,你可能想知道是否有其他类似的开发工具可供选择。事实上,有很多其他的开发工具可以帮助你制作Andr
2023-05-06
app 开发 app 开发
APP指的是应用程序(Application),是一种设计用于移动设备和智能手机的软件程序。作为现代移动设备和智能手机不可分割的部分,APP通过提供在设备上安装和使用的功能和服务,帮助用户完成各种任务。APP开发是一项让开发者们设计、创建和部署应用程序的过
2023-05-06